How Style3D Accelerates Fashion Prototyping

Style3D's AI-driven 3D simulation connects design to production, reducing sampling and automating patterns and trims. The platform has revolutionized how brands approach prototyping through AI-powered 3D simulations that use advanced cloth physics to visualize how garments will fit, drape, and move on digital avatars before any physical samples are created.

During my conversations with pattern makers and designers, one professional mentioned working with global teams across Paris, London, and Milan. The challenge of coordinating physical samples across these locations was eating up weeks of development time. Style3D solves this by enabling real-time collaboration on virtual garments.

With Style3D, brands can assess the fit of a product before any samples are made, significantly reducing the need for physical samples, helping minimize waste and improve speed to market. The platform's AI fabric modeling technology understands material properties like stretch, weight, and drape behavior, meaning designers can test different fabrics virtually and see accurate representations of how the final garment will perform.

What Makes The New Black Ideal for Generative Design

The New Black leverages artificial intelligence to generate unique and trendy clothing designs, catering primarily to fashion designers, brands, and enthusiasts looking to innovate and streamline their creative processes. The platform excels at transforming initial concepts into photorealistic fashion designs while maintaining brand consistency across hundreds of variations from a single input.

Designers and brands can describe their fashion ideas in plain language, and the AI interprets these descriptions and generates original, one-of-a-kind designs. One feature that particularly impressed me is its integration with PANTONE swatches, ensuring that generated designs use accurate, production-ready colors rather than approximations. For brands working on line planning, this level of precision is crucial.

The New Black is a comprehensive AI-powered fashion design platform trusted by over 500,000 designers and brands, empowering users to generate innovative, unique designs for clothing, bags, shoes, accessories, and even store interiors through advanced AI algorithms.

The platform accepts sketches, text prompts, or reference images as inputs, offering flexibility that allows designers to work in whatever format feels most natural to their creative process. The AI then generates multiple variations while preserving the core design intent.

How fashionINSTA Transforms Sketch to Pattern Conversion

This is where my personal experience becomes most relevant. fashionINSTA addresses the biggest bottleneck in fashion production: converting design sketches into accurate, production-ready patterns.

AI-Powered Fashion Pattern Intelligence System Interface

The fashionINSTA interface demonstrates how AI pattern intelligence transforms sketches into production-ready patterns with interactive refinement capabilities.

Traditional pattern making takes 6-8 hours per garment. Our AI platform reduces this to approximately 10 minutes while learning from your existing pattern library to maintain brand-specific fit characteristics. This represents the most significant advancement in pattern making software since the introduction of CAD systems.

The material-aware algorithms understand how different fabrics behave and adjust pattern specifications accordingly. This means a sketch for a stretch knit dress will generate different pattern adjustments than the same design in woven cotton.

What makes fashionINSTA particularly powerful is the platform's ability to preserve what we call "brand fit DNA." Every brand has unique fit preferences, and our AI learns these nuances from your historical patterns. This ensures consistency across new designs while dramatically accelerating the development process.

AI's Role in Trend Forecasting for Fashion

AI models track everything from runway shows to social media, with massive scale of data that allows AI to detect early signals of trends – sometimes months before they become visible on the mainstream market. AI trend forecasting analyzes massive datasets including social media engagement, runway show coverage, and sales performance to identify emerging patterns up to 24 months in advance.

Examples include dotted prints, the flat-thong sandal and the color yellow, trends that have all shown up on runways at this year's fashion weeks, demonstrating the accuracy of AI-powered trend prediction.

These insights go beyond basic color or silhouette trends. Modern AI can identify emerging fabric preferences, sustainability concerns, and even cultural movements that will influence fashion choices.

For designers using tools like The New Black or fashionINSTA, trend insights can be directly integrated into the design process. This creates a feedback loop where trend data informs initial concepts, which are then rapidly prototyped and tested.

However, AI cannot do fashion prediction on its own, as the human aspect still remains essential, emphasizing the importance of combining AI capabilities with human expertise.

How AI Tools Reduce Physical Sampling in Fashion

Physical sampling has been fashion's biggest resource drain. AI tools address this through multiple approaches:

Virtual Fitting: Platforms like Style3D provide physics-based simulations that accurately represent how garments will fit and move on real bodies.

Material Simulation: AI understands fabric properties and can predict drape, stretch, and recovery without physical testing.

Fit Prediction: Pattern intelligence platforms learn from successful fits to predict how new designs will perform.

3D software significantly reduces reliance on physical samples, offering highly accurate virtual fittings and fabric simulations. While some tactile evaluations remain important, advanced 3D tools minimize waste and accelerate production timelines dramatically.

One manufacturer I spoke with reported reducing sample production by 75% after implementing AI-powered virtual prototyping. The remaining 25% of samples are now used for final validation rather than initial development.
